You have three options.

1) Open Wordpad directly and then do a FILE > OPEN to open your saved
document.

2) You can associate files that end in .rtf with Wordpad and not Word. To do
this open up My Computer, Click on Edit, Click on Folder Options, Click File
Type tab, Scroll down to rtf files, Click on Change button, Select Wordpad
from the list of programs that appears, make sure the "Always use the
selected program to open this kind of file" box is ticked, click on Apply
and Click OK.

3) Right click on the file and select Open With from the menu that appears,
select Wordpad.
